rosstimothy ef859498bc Vendor gravitational/trace/trail in api (#51032)
* Vendor gravitational/trace/trail in api

Pulling in the trail package directly in api will allow the trace
module to shed the grpc-go dependency. This needs to land prior
to https://github.com/gravitational/trace/pull/112 being included
in a new version of trace.

There should be no noticable change in the api depdency tree since
it already depends on grpc-go. Some additional items from the
trace/internal package were also vendored within trail as needed.
Additionally, some of the public api of trail that was not being
consumed has been made private.

package trail
import (
"errors"
"fmt"
"io"
"os"
"strings"
"testing"
"github.com/gravitational/trace"
"github.com/stretchr/testify/assert"
"google.golang.org/grpc/codes"
"google.golang.org/grpc/metadata"
"google.golang.org/grpc/status"
)
// TestConversion makes sure we convert all trace supported errors
// to and back from GRPC codes
func TestConversion(t *testing.T) {
tests := []struct {
name string
err error
fn func(error) bool
}{
{
name: "io.EOF",
err: io.EOF,
fn: func(err error) bool { return errors.Is(err, io.EOF) },
},
{
name: "os.ErrNotExist",
err: os.ErrNotExist,
fn: trace.IsNotFound,
},
{
name: "AccessDenied",
err: trace.AccessDenied("access denied"),
fn: trace.IsAccessDenied,
},
{
name: "AlreadyExists",
err: trace.AlreadyExists("already exists"),
fn: trace.IsAlreadyExists,
},
{
name: "BadParameter",
err: trace.BadParameter("bad parameter"),
fn: trace.IsBadParameter,
},
{
name: "CompareFailed",
err: trace.CompareFailed("compare failed"),
fn: trace.IsCompareFailed,
},
{
name: "ConnectionProblem",
err: trace.ConnectionProblem(nil, "problem"),
fn: trace.IsConnectionProblem,
},
{
name: "LimitExceeded",
err: trace.LimitExceeded("exceeded"),
fn: trace.IsLimitExceeded,
},
{
name: "NotFound",
err: trace.NotFound("not found"),
fn: trace.IsNotFound,
},
{
name: "NotImplemented",
err: trace.NotImplemented("not implemented"),
fn: trace.IsNotImplemented,
},
{
name: "Aggregated BadParameter",
err: trace.NewAggregate(trace.BadParameter("bad parameter")),
fn: trace.IsBadParameter,
},
}
for _, test := range tests {
t.Run(test.name, func(t *testing.T) {
grpcError := ToGRPC(test.err)
assert.Equal(t, test.err.Error(), status.Convert(grpcError).Message(), "Error message mismatch")
out := FromGRPC(grpcError)
assert.True(t, test.fn(out), "Predicate failed")
assert.Regexp(t, ".*trail_test.go.*", line(trace.DebugReport(out)))
assert.NotRegexp(t, ".*trail.go.*", line(trace.DebugReport(out)))
})
}
}
// TestNil makes sure conversions of nil to and from GRPC are no-op
func TestNil(t *testing.T) {
out := FromGRPC(ToGRPC(nil))
assert.NoError(t, out)
}
// TestFromEOF makes sure that non-grpc error such as io.EOF is preserved well.
func TestFromEOF(t *testing.T) {
out := FromGRPC(trace.Wrap(io.EOF))
assert.True(t, trace.IsEOF(out))
}
// TestTraces makes sure we pass traces via metadata and can decode it back
func TestTraces(t *testing.T) {
err := trace.BadParameter("param")
meta := metadata.New(nil)
setDebugInfo(err, meta)
err2 := FromGRPC(ToGRPC(err), meta)
assert.Regexp(t, ".*trail_test.go.*", line(trace.DebugReport(err)))
assert.Regexp(t, ".*trail_test.go.*", line(trace.DebugReport(err2)))
}
func line(s string) string {
return strings.ReplaceAll(s, "\n", "")
}
func TestToGRPCKeepCode(t *testing.T) {
err := status.Errorf(codes.PermissionDenied, "denied")
err = ToGRPC(err)
if code := status.Code(err); code != codes.PermissionDenied {
t.Errorf("after ToGRPC, got error code %v, want %v, error: %v", code, codes.PermissionDenied, err)
}
err = FromGRPC(err)
if !trace.IsAccessDenied(err) {
t.Errorf("after FromGRPC, trace.IsAccessDenied is false, want true, error: %v", err)
}
}
func TestToGRPC_statusError(t *testing.T) {
err1 := status.Errorf(codes.NotFound, "not found")
err2 := fmt.Errorf("go wrap: %w", trace.Wrap(err1))
tests := []struct {
name string
err error
want error
}{
{
name: "unwrapped status",
err: err1,
want: err1, // Exact same error.
},
{
name: "wrapped status",
err: err2,
want: status.Errorf(codes.NotFound, "%s", err2.Error()),
},
}
for _, test := range tests {
t.Run(test.name, func(t *testing.T) {
err := ToGRPC(test.err)
got, ok := status.FromError(err)
if !ok {
t.Fatalf("Failed to convert `got` to a status.Status: %#v", err)
}
want, ok := status.FromError(test.want)
if !ok {
t.Fatalf("Failed to convert `want` to a status.Status: %#v", err)
}
if got.Code() != want.Code() || got.Message() != want.Message() {
t.Errorf("ToGRPC = %#v, want %#v", got, test.want)
}
})
}
}
